We are seeking a highly technical and strategic Senior Developer Relations Manager within the Healthcare and Life Sciences vertical, to join our team, with a focus on engaging developer ecosystems across emerging technology domains. In this pivotal role, you will work directly with software solution providers, developers, and industry professionals to foster the adoption of NVIDIA’s sophisticated AI and computing platforms. The ideal candidate brings a blend of deep technical expertise and commercial go-to-market experience, combined with a passion for developer advocacy and a talent for communicating how NVIDIA technology can solve sophisticated, real-world challenges.

What You'll Be Doing

  • Support developers in your HCLS segment as a technical consultant, resolving issues and promoting NVIDIA technology adoption.
  • Accelerate critical workloads by demonstrating ground breaking solutions that integrate the core NVIDIA stack into developer products, platforms, and pipelines.
  • Advise on the technical enablement resources—such as sample code, guides, demonstration pipelines, and tools to highlight the application of technologies in solving real-world problems.
  • Guide partners and healthcare and life science startups through onboarding and integration with NVIDIA’s programs, fostering co-innovation and the development of next-generation solutions.
  • Map, track, and supervise the developer ecosystem to identify growth opportunities, inform technology roadmaps, and shape adoption strategies.
  • Collaborate multi-functionally with solution architects, engineering, product management, and marketing to drive developer engagement and optimize partner adoption strategies.
  • Collaborate with partner engineering teams, technical leaders, and decision-makers to identify objectives, address technical hurdles, and promote guidelines for successful integrations.
  • Represent and advocate for the partner technical needs and feedback to NVIDIA’s internal product and engineering teams, supplying actionable insights from field deployments to influence product roadmaps.

What We Need to See

  •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Computer Science, Engineering, or a related field (or equivalent experience).
  • A minimum of 8-10+ years of overall professional experience in the healthcare industry in software engineering, developer relations, technical partnerships, or customer-facing technical roles including 5+ years of direct hands-on experience working with software & technology companies in EMEA.
  • Proven experience leading, partnering, and scaling developer programs at major healthcare companies, or within relevant verticals.
  • Significant technical proficiency in high-performance computing, cloud, AI/ML, and/or vertical-specific frameworks and libraries.
  • Excellent interpersonal skills with the ability to distill complex technical concepts for diverse technical and non-technical audiences from engineers to executives.
  • Experience leading technical collaborations with engineering and product teams - including architectural design, code reviews, technical mentorship, and delivery of technical talks or workshops.
  • Skilled in coordinating complex technical projects, addressing needs, prioritizing concerns, and collaborating with various teams.
  • Commercial proficiency/experience: strong commercial acumen and the ability to assess and qualify business opportunities (for both parties).

Ways to Stand Out from the Crowd

  • Hands-on experience building or optimizing vertical-specific solutions (e.g., network stacks, bidding algorithms, data pipelines, etc.).
  • Familiarity with advanced computing, AI, and/or GPU acceleration platforms such as CUDA, Triton, NeMo.
  • Track record in crafting and implementing systems for real-time processing and low-latency decision-making.
  • Experience working in customer-facing technical roles focused on technical evaluation and product integration.
  • Background in developing product partnerships and executing GTM strategies with external organizations/partners as well as experience working with developers building AI-embedded products within Healthcare & Life Sciences.
